Output 15903a3abf5749292054c4d9dad0bc17cab1acb560942e214e8b377a7932cd9a:0

value
48328871
script pubkey
OP_0 OP_PUSHBYTES_20 0ef1c77f8614644f92006c15ae04e5851775dcfd
address
tb1qpmcuwluxz3jylysqds26up89s5thth8allzw72
transaction
15903a3abf5749292054c4d9dad0bc17cab1acb560942e214e8b377a7932cd9a